The Role:

The Outbound Automation Operations Supervisor is a key leadership role within a multi-client 3PL distribution environment, responsible for overseeing outbound functions including picking, packing, kitting, and order fulfillment. This role ensures outbound operations meet client service level agreements (SLAs) with speed, accuracy, and efficiency.

The supervisor leads and supports a team of associates, helping to drive performance,maintainoperational flow, and uphold quality standards. Success in this role requires a hands-on, results-driven leader who thrives in a fast-paced, service-focused environment.

About Cart.com

Cart.com is the leading provider of unified commerce and logistics solutions that enable B2C and B2B companies to master omnichannel commerce, from product discovery to order delivery.

The company’s enterprise-grade software, services and logistics infrastructure, including its own network of fulfillment and distribution centers, are used by some of the world’s most beloved brands and most complex companies to streamline operations across channels and drive more efficient growth.

With over 6,000 customers, 1,600 employees and a nationwide network of 18 fulfillment and distribution centers spanning over 10 million square feet, Cart.com is transforming how commerce works in the omnichannel world.
